sqlserver2012数据库: 深入了解微软SQL Server 2012的特性与应用

访客 by:访客 分类:数据库 时间:2024/08/04 阅读:44 评论:0

SQL Server 2012 是微软推出的一款关系型数据库管理系统,它为企业数据管理提供了强大而灵活的解决方案。作为SQL Server系列的一部分,2012版本在性能、可扩展性、安全性和易用性方面进行了显著提升,使其成为数据密集型应用以及企业解决方案的首选。本文将详细探讨SQL Server 2012的主要特性、优势、使用场景及其优化策略。

主要特性

SQL Server 2012引入了许多新的功能和增强特性,这些特性使得数据库管理更加高效和便捷。以下是一些主要特性:

1. **AlwaysOn 可用性组**:这是SQL Server 2012的一个重大创新,提供高可用性和灾难恢复功能,允许用户在多个数据库之间创建可用性组,以提高高可用性解决方案的灵活性。

2. **列存储索引**:列存储索引的引入极大地提升了数据仓库性能,它允许在按列而非按行存储的基础上查询数据,从而在执行大规模查询时显著提高查询速度。

3. **数据质量服务(DQS)**:DQS提供了一系列工具,使用户能够识别和修复数据质量问题,从而提高数据的准确性和一致性。这对企业进行数据分析尤为重要。

4. **动态数据掩码**:这一功能可以帮助用户隐蔽敏感信息,在查询和报告中保护个人身份信息(PII),从而提高系统的安全性。

5. **内存优化表**:SQL Server 2012支持通过内存优化数据结构来提高性能。这使得数据库的操作速度更快,尤其是在处理大量并发事务时。

SQL Server 2012的优势

SQL Server 2012以其众多优势而脱颖而出,推动了企业的成功数据管理。

1. **高可用性**:通过AlwaysOn可用性组和数据库镜像等功能,SQL Server 2012确保了业务的连续性,减少了故障恢复的时间。

2. **扩展性和灵活性**:无论是小型企业还是大型公司,SQL Server 2012都能根据需求提供灵活的解决方案,并随着业务的发展进行扩展和定制。

3. **安全性**:SQL Server 2012的安全功能相当全面,提供了动态数据掩码、行级安全等机制,确保数据安全,保护企业敏感信息。

4. **报表服务的改进**:新版本中的SQL Server报表服务提供了更丰富的可视化功能和交互性,帮助企业以更优质的方式展示和分析数据。

5. **易于管理**:SQL Server 2012的管理工具更加友好,增强了数据库的监控、备份和恢复的能力,减轻了数据库管理人员的工作负担。

使用场景与案例分析

SQL Server 2012因其强大的功能,适用于多种行业和场景:

1. **企业级业务应用**:许多大型企业正在使用SQL Server 2012来处理日常交易数据。凭借其高可用性和性能,企业能够确保客户服务的连续性并对业务数据进行实时分析。

2. **数据仓库与商业智能**:具有列存储索引的特性使得SQL Server 2012非常适合构建数据仓库和商业智能解决方案,企业能够快速洞察数据趋势,进行精准营销和决策。

3. **云计算与虚拟化**:SQL Server 2012支持在虚拟环境和云环境中部署,让企业能够灵活调整其IT基础架构,更好地应对业务变化。

4. **数据集成与ETL**:借助SQL Server集成服务(SSIS),企业能够轻松进行数据整合和转换,以满足不同业务需求。

5. **金融与保险行业**:在高安全性、合规性要求的金融行业,SQL Server 2012的安全特性和强大的报告功能使其成为可靠的选择。

优化策略

为确保SQL Server 2012的最佳性能,实施一些优化策略是至关重要的:

1. **定期维护**:包括索引重建和统计信息更新,以提升查询性能,并确保高效的数据访问。

2. **监控与调优**:使用SQL Server的性能监控工具,如SQL Server Profiler和Performance Monitor,及时识别瓶颈并根据实际需求进行调优。

3. **使用适当的索引**:根据查询类型和数据访问模式设计合适的索引结构,避免过度索引或缺乏索引带来的性能问题。

4. **优化数据库架构**:良好的数据库设计是性能的基础,应确保数据表结构合理,关系定义清晰,无冗余数据。

5. **利用内存优势**:对于性能敏感的应用,使用内存优化表来运行需要快速响应的大量事务,以获得最佳性能。

SQL Server 2012作为一款功能强大的数据库管理系统,为企业提供了可靠的解决方案,以支持高效的数据管理和分析。通过合理的使用和配置策略,企业能够充分发挥SQL Server 2012的潜力,推动业务的可持续发展。在快速变化的市场环境中,掌握并利用SQL Server 2012无疑是企业构建数据驱动业务的关键。

非特殊说明,本文版权归原作者所有,转载请注明出处

本文地址:https://chinaasp.com/202408995.html


TOP